WebOct 13, 2024 · Pain is an especially common cause of aggression in dogs. 1 Your suddenly aggressive dog may have an injury or an illness that's causing major discomfort and stress. Some possible causes of pain include arthritis, bone fractures, internal injuries, various tumors, and lacerations. Other illnesses may affect your dog's brain, leading to ...

WebMar 11, 2024 · Five Types of Dog Aggression. Your dog may have one or more of the five types of aggression: Interdog household aggression. Fear aggression toward other dogs. Conflict aggression (towards familiar people, formerly known as dominance aggression) Fear aggression towards humans. Predatory aggression.
